<< Let me know if you find a good source of hardwood. I naively thought that I
could go to a local lumberyard any old time and buy walnut.  >>

In most areas there tend to be "hardwood specialists."  Go to your local fine 
cabinet or furniture maker and ask who in town sells specialty hardwoods.  
Another good source of info is your local woodworking supply shop (in New 
England they've got a chain of places called "Woodworkers Warehouse").   I've 
lived in a few small towns and in every one I have found places that have 
your typical hardwoods (walnut) along with specialty woods (koa, bubinga, 
zebrawood, etc.).  You can also ask luthiers where to get specialty woods.
